Transaction 0509bc2bdef7a6010dfd1e84092bff726847d782c2997c0eb4cac48a52e156ca

1 Input
2 Outputs
  • 0509bc2bdef7a6010dfd1e84092bff726847d782c2997c0eb4cac48a52e156ca:0
  • value  5024317
    address  3KSzMhJdTHUddtqKU8TYXZ5k1mA5yddWqb
  • 0509bc2bdef7a6010dfd1e84092bff726847d782c2997c0eb4cac48a52e156ca:1
  • value  26930817
    address  3CFSNw7PsaRGkdiU8GafzadJaePtL5ezWZ